Cooking like a chef is a skill that anyone can learn. With the right guidance and some practice, you too can become a master in the kitchen.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ced home cook, learn the secrets of the pros and get the best tips from the experts on how to cook like a chef.

1. Start with the Basics

When learning how to cook like a chef, the first step is to understand the basics of cooking. This means learning the fundamentals, such as knife skills, understanding flavor profiles, and basic cooking techniques. A great way to do this is to take a basic cooking class or watch some cooking videos online. Once you’ve mastered the basics, you can move on to more challenging recipes.

2. Invest in Quality Kitchen Equipment

One of the most important tips for becoming a better cook is to invest in quality kitchen equipment. This means having the right tools for the job, such as a sharp knife, a good set of pots and pans, and a reliable oven. Quality kitchen equipment will not only make your cooking easier, but it will also help you create delicious meals.

3. Use Fresh, High-Quality Ingredients

When cooking like a chef, it’s important to use the freshest, highest-quality ingredients you can find. Fresh ingredients will make your dish taste better, and the flavors will be more intense. Always read labels and look for ingredients that are sustainably sourced, organic, and locally grown.

4. Taste as You Go

One of the most important tips for learning how to cook like a chef is to taste as you go. This means tasting your food and adding seasonings or ingredients accordingly. This will ensure that your dish has the right balance of flavors and that it will come out perfectly cooked.

5. Get Creative in the Kitchen

Chefs are known for their creativity, so don’t be afraid to experiment in the kitchen. Try new ingredients, flavor combinations, and cooking techniques. You may be surprised by the delightful dishes you can create.

6. Learn from Others

Learn from the experts. Follow your favorite chefs on social media, read their cookbooks, and watch their cooking shows. You’ll gain valuable knowledge and techniques that you can apply to your own cooking.

7. Practice Makes Perfect

The more you practice, the better you will become. Don’t be afraid to make mistakes, as this is how we learn. With each dish, you will gain more experience and confidence in the kitchen.

8. Have Fun in the Kitchen

Most importantly, have fun in the kitchen and enjoy the process. Cooking should be a joyful experience, and you’ll be more likely to create delicious dishes when you’re having a good time. So, put on some music, pour yourself a glass of wine, and get to cooking like a chef!
